[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]I taught at a Big Three for years and now work for MCPS. The pay and benefits are night and day - MCPS has it all over privates, including the "best" privates. I am fortunate to teach a privileged public school population and have relatively few big issues to contend with day to day. I know that my job would be much harder in a different environment with a different population. In that respect, most privates can choose their student populations and therefore teaching at a private is "easier" in that sense. In general, teachers in private schools are second-income workers. Virtually all of them have a spouse who makes a major breadwinner salary, affording the teacher the option to choose to work at a private school, where pay and benefits are not very competitive. To my knowledge, none of the private schools offers a pay and benefit package sufficient to enable a teacher to make a meaningful contribution to family income, health insurance, etc. [/quote] I taught at a popular private and agree. It's much easier to teach in a private because the problem children are counseled out. You don't have difficult SPED kids and there is zero ESOL. My job as an FCPS elementary Title I teacher is way, way more challenging. I like the challenge and feeling like I'm making a difference. My kids at the private were polite and nice, but honestly, anyone could basically teach them and they'd be fine. I feel way more needed and impactful at my job now.[/quote]
